Cardamoma Little History! Cardamom Is Native To The Forest Of South India, Where It Grows Wild. Second Only To The Spice Saffron In Value, Cardamom Is One Of The Worlds Most Expensive Spice. Cardamom Can Enhance Both Sweet And Savory Dishes. It Has Been Important In Indian Cuisine For Thousands Of Years, Being A Useful Ingredient In Sumptuous Curries To Adding A Camphoric Flavor To Indian Masala Chai.
